Welding Career Overview

If you enjoy working with tools and like the idea of creating strong structures, then perhaps a career in welding would be a good fit. Welding is the most common way of permanently joining metal parts using heat applied to metal pieces, melting and fusing them to form a permanent bond. Welding is used in shipbuilding, automobile manufacturing and repair, aerospace applications, and thousands of other manufacturing activities. Welding also is used to join beams when constructing buildings, bridges, and other structures, and to join pipes in pipelines, power plants, and refineries.

Welding workers typically plan work from drawings or specifications or use their knowledge to analyze the parts that need to be joined. They are responsible for selecting and setting up welding equipment, executing the planned welds, and examining welds to ensure that they meet standards or specifications. Highly skilled welders often are trained to work with a wide variety of materials in addition to steel, such as titanium, aluminum, or plastics. A career in welding requires a great deal of skill and concentration. It also provides one with a profound feeling of accomplishment, with lasting structures standing as the result of the work performed.

Welding Training & Education

Formal training for welders is advised and takes anywhere from 6 months to 2 years to complete on average. While some employers provide basic training, they prefer to hire workers with experience or more formal training. Courses include:

  • Blueprint reading
  • Shop mathematics
  • Mechanical drawing
  • Physics
  • Chemistry
  • Metallurgy
  • Electricity

Knowledge of computers is becoming increasingly important, especially for welding, soldering, and brazing machine operators, who are becoming more responsible for the programming of computer-controlled machines. Welders can advance to more skilled welding jobs with additional training and experience. For example, they may become welding technicians, supervisors, inspectors, or instructors.

Welding Career & Salary Outlook

Job prospects for welders should be excellent as employers report difficulty finding enough qualified employees. In addition, it is projected that more vacancies will occur because as a large number of workers will retire over the next decade. Because almost every manufacturing industry uses welding at some stage of manufacturing or in the repair and maintenance of equipment welders will always remain in demand.

The construction industry is expected to have solid growth over the next decade and as a result, an increasing demand for welders. Government funding for shipbuilding as well as for infrastructure repairs and improvements are expected to generate additional welding jobs. While salary varies among welders, according to the Bureau of Labor Statistics, the middle 50 percent earned between $11.90 and $18.05 as of May 2004.

Career Fields/Specializations

Welder Career

While there are numerous types of welding, arc welding is the most common. Welders use many different forms of technology in order to get the job done. Standard arc welding involves using a strong electrical current to help separate pieces of metal to melt together, forming a solid bond.

There are many other ways in which to weld in addition to arc welding. As a result, the most skilled welders will be the most versatile, enabling them to work on various different types of projects. That being said, many welders assume a specialty in which they excel and have particular interest.

Underwater Welder Career

One type of welding specialty is underwater welding. The applications of underwater welding are diverse—it is often used to repair ships, offshore oil platforms, and pipelines. Steel is the most common material welded for these projects. For deepwater welds and other applications where high strength is necessary, dry underwater welding is most commonly used.

In general, assuring the integrity of underwater welds can be difficult especially for wet underwater welds, because defects are difficult to detect if the defects are beneath the surface of the weld. For the structures being welded by wet underwater welding, inspection following welding may be more difficult than for welds deposited in air. Assuring the integrity of such underwater welds may be more difficult, and there is a risk that defects may remain undetected. Due to all of the possible complications that can arise in underwater welding, this career takes a great deal of training, skill, and precision.

Welding Operator Career

Welding operators are not so much responsible for doing the physical welding, but are in charge of monitoring machines or robots that are used to do welding procedures. Automated welding is used in an increasing number of production processes, as a result, the technology must be supervised by a welding machine operator.

Welding, soldering, and brazing machine setters, operators, and tenders follow specified layouts, work orders, or blueprints. Operators must load parts correctly and constantly monitor the machine to ensure that it produces the desired bond. This requires less hands-on stress, but allows one to be responsible for ensuring a high quality finished product.

Welding Technicians Career

Welding technicians are those individuals who are flexible enough to understand the duties of both welders and welding engineers. Welding technicians are mainly problem solvers or troubleshooters. Most educational institutions that offer welding technician programs require individuals to spend a great deal of time learning about the various processes involved in welding and develop some sort of basic skill on each. Welding technicians are exposed to the various testing and evaluation methods and ways that weld quality can be affected.

They commonly take courses in metallurgy and materials science to understand how the structural makeup of various materials affects the way they can be welded. Welding technicians are also exposed to automation and robotic applications of welding and understand how to troubleshoot these automated applications. Such a career requires an individual that can multi-task well and has a broad understanding of many different facets of the welding industry.

Welding Inspector Career

Welding inspectors are typically expected to perform daily inspection and supervision of welders. They are responsible for achieving safety standards and for assessing effectiveness of working practices and systems. Welding inspectors should continuously be focused on how best to improve welding systems, along with monitoring personal and team performance.

They maintain inspection strategies and implement and execute all of the technical inspection monitoring. While performing these duties they must provide technical support where required to the welding operations and maintenance teams. Welding inspectors must have an excellent understanding of the necessary procedures and techniques used in welding and often transition to this role after having spent time as a welding specialist.
